IDF Discovers Extensive Underground Tunnel Network Linking Gaza's North and South
TL;DR Summary
The IDF uncovered a 10 km underground tunnel network connecting the north and south of the Gaza Strip, passing under a hospital and a university, which was used for inter-divisional communication between different terror divisions. The military gained operational control, examined the network, and destroyed large portions of it, finding rooms, storage areas, weapons, military equipment, and the bodies of terrorists inside.
